Case Studies – Athos

Brief

SY Athos  – 63m Holland Yachtbouw Schooner 

SY Athos called upon BMComposites to engineer, manufacture and install 3 large carbon-fibre deck hatches as part of its award-winning refit at Huisfit in 2022.  The deck hatches measuring over 4.5m in length replaced the existing aluminium hatches which, due to their size and weight, were overloading the hardware, failing to seal properly and were proving difficult to operate. 

Approach

Prior to the yacht’s departure, BMComposites fully 3D-scanned the existing deck apertures including the existing scupper systems and mating sealing featuresThe scan data was later used as a reference when re-modelling the new hatches using 3D CAD packages.  As well as the hatches themselves, a new custom-designed hardware package was designed and manufacturedThis included multiple closing dogs with a central locking system and heavy-duty panto-graphing hinges.  Design and manufacture was carried out under the watchful eye of the Bureau Veritas Classification Society, which was included in the BMComposites end-to-end project management role.  

The Result

After manufacture and painting in its facility in Palma, the hatches were shipped to Huisfit and mounted on board by the BMComposites install team.  Due to the extensive use of 3D scanning, the hatches fitted the existing apertures perfectly and were installed rapidly with minimal impact on other works on board. 

Sy Athos went on to win the coveted ‘Best Refitted Yacht’ award at the World Superyacht Awards 2023.
